Feelings of Contrast at Test Reduce False Memory in the Deese/Roediger-McDermott Paradigm

False memories in the Deese/Roediger-McDermott (DRM) paradigm are explained in terms of the interplay between error-inflating and error-editing (e.g., monitoring) mechanisms.
